Body
When and Where
1999 Grand Prix began on October 11, 1999[12]. It ended on October 24, 1999[13]. Recorded location include Preston Guild Hall[8] and Preston[9]. It is in the country of United Kingdom[4].
Context
Part of include Grand Prix[10] and Snooker season 1999/2000[11], a sports season[19]. 1999 Grand Prix's instance of is recorded as snooker tournament[5]. It followed 1998 Grand Prix[6]. It was followed by 2000 Grand Prix[7].
